Horse And Groom Public House
Horse And Groom Public House is a pub in Clapham, Bedford, England which is located on High Street. Horse And Groom Public House is situated nearby to Clapham Methodist Church, as well as near Ursula Taylor Church of England School.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Church of St Thomas of Canterbury, Clapham, Bedfordshire
Church
Photo: Oliver White,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Church of St Thomas of Canterbury is a parish church and Grade I listed building in Clapham, Bedfordshire, England. It became a listed building on 13 July 1964. Church of St Thomas of Canterbury, Clapham, Bedfordshire is situated 510 feet northeast of Horse And Groom Public House.
Park Wood, Bedford
Nature reserve
Park Wood is a 5.2 hectare Local Nature Reserve located in the Brickhill area of Bedford. It is owned by Bedford Borough Council and managed by the council with the assistance of the Friends of Park Wood.
Bedford & County Golf Club
Golf course
Bedford & County Golf Club is a golf club to the northeast of Clapham, Bedfordshire, England. It was established in 1912. As of 1995 the course measured 6,290 yards.

Brickhill
Suburb
Photo: Simonxag, Public domain.
Brickhill is a civil parish and electoral ward within northern Bedford in Bedfordshire, England. The boundaries of Brickhill are approximately Kimbolton Road to the east, Bedford Park and the old Bedford cemetery to the south, with Cemetery Hill and the Manton Heights Industrial Estate to the west.
Biddenham
Village
Photo: Stephen McKay,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Biddenham is a village and civil parish in the Borough of Bedford in Bedfordshire, England, located around 2 miles west of Bedford town centre near the A428 road. It forms part of the wider Bedford urban area.
Oakley
Village
Photo: Mr Biz,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Oakley is a village and civil parish located in the Borough of Bedford in Bedfordshire, England, about four miles northwest of Bedford along the River Great Ouse. Oakley is situated 1½ miles northwest of Horse And Groom Public House.
